The National Museum of the Great Lakes is owned and operated by the Great Lakes Historical Society. Its mission is to preserve and make known the history of the Great Lakes. The museum fulfills this mission by: 1.) Operating the National Museum of the Great Lakes in Toledo, Ohio; 2.) Publishing our quarterly journal Inland Seas®; 3.) Conducting original underwater archaeology across the Great Lakes; 4.) Offering educational programs; and 5.) Conserving 20th century Great Lakes history with the Col. James M. Schoonmaker Museum Ship and the Museum Tug Ohio.
